BBC's Panorama program has highlighted the difficulties some sufferers face when seeking an NHS ADHD diagnosis. In the past, it could be difficult to receive an ADHD diagnosis when you didn't have funds or access to private clinics. The NHS now lets patients access private assessments via its "Right to Choice" procedure, which makes it easier to receive diagnosed.

The program focuses on the issues with private clinics and demonstrates how the NHS struggles to meet the demand for ADHD assessments. Despite the fact that the NHS constitution stipulates that patients should receive an assessment within 18 weeks of a GP referral, wait times are now at record-high levels. People who can't afford to wait are faced with a stark decision: either to continue struggling without diagnosis or pay for a private examination.

An adult ADHD assessment will consist of an interview and questionnaires. The assessment will also include a review of previous behaviours and current issues. The psychiatric doctor will determine whether you have ADHD and how it impacts your daily life. The psychiatric specialist will discuss the options for your medication and provide you a written evaluation. The cost of an ADHD evaluation typically ranges between PS750 and PS1000.

ADHD assessments are conducted by Psychiatrists who are trained or Clinical Nurse Specialists. They will assess your symptoms and behavior in different contexts, including at home, at school and at work. In some cases they may suggest cognitive therapies or other medication. These treatments can help control your symptoms and improve your performance in all aspects of your life.

Psychiatry-UK is a leading provider of NHS-funded ADHD assessments and treatment for adults in England. They have contracts with a variety of Integrated Care Boards (ICBCs) and NHS Trusts. They have access to NICE guidelines, which means that they can offer the highest quality of assessment. They can also assist with financing through Right To Choose if you are refused a referral from your GP.

The price of an adult ADHD assessment includes a face-toface or online video consultation as well as a diagnostic interview. an extensive written report. The report can be shared with your GP. The cost of an ADHD assessment includes a prescription when ADHD medication is required. This includes correspondence with your GP while you are being titrated on medication and stabilized.

The BBC's investigation into private adhd assessment maidstone clinics that give out faulty diagnoses of ADHD has exposed the glaring mismatch between demand and capacity of services provided by the NHS. The NHS does not have enough specialists to satisfy demand.

There are long waiting lists for NHS treatment and assessment. The government has stated that it will focus on improving access to adult ADHD services as part of its Green Paper on special educational requirements and alternative treatment.

In the meantime there are a variety of organisations that provide adult ADHD assessments and treatment. For example, Psychiatry-UK has contracts with Integrated Care Boards and NHS England to assess and prescribe ADHD treatment in England.

An average patient journey which includes a diagnostic assessment and a written report regularly scheduled follow-up appointments as well as an official shared care letter to your GP is priced at PS1200-PS2000. This does not include any prescribed non-ADHD medication. It also does not include the cost of any prescriptions that are requested outside of follow-up appointments.

Certain families and those with ADHD utilize private services to prevent the pitfalls or barriers to access to public health services. However, these services do not guarantee that the assessments or clinical reports they offer are correct. In addition, they might not always follow the guidelines of the National Institute for Clinical Excellence.

Some private healthcare providers may profit from the need for help and desperate nature of their patients, but fail to perform thorough ADHD assessments. They may not be aware of the nature of ADHD or have a preconceived notion of the disorder. This has led to sporadic accounts of young people with significant comorbidities being denied access to medical care or even denied the diagnosis of ADHD.
